#zdoomvets is a semi-private Doom community discussion channel, a splinter from #zdoom. The channel was initially founded in July 2004 by Sarge Baldy and others as a means of escaping certain topics of discussion found uninteresting, such as those relating to Doom 3, which was released some months afterward. The channel maintained a small base for over a year, with little discussion. However, it was revived in January 2006 as the result of a confrontation between Fraggle, Bloodshedder and Sarge Baldy.
